Output fec0bb578d678b79987839911cb7c3e4a6ab82eae2100517c4f3c9d57f5a0862:1

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7619d98502cd7a96b819d012801734d24c15d77f OP_EQUAL
address
3CTUdFJWqHD5Dam4ZKZRyxEXF1YLXZQQ3g
transaction
fec0bb578d678b79987839911cb7c3e4a6ab82eae2100517c4f3c9d57f5a0862
spent
true